Highlights :: Catalyst '09



In case you didn't get a chance to attend this year, I've taken my favorite "nuggets" of wisdom from a portion of the lineup of inspiring leaders who presented at Catalyst '09. Make a mark on the world for Jesus Christ!

Andy Stanley
  • What man is a man that doesn't leave the world better?
  • God is not “invited” to play a role in our story; we’ve been privileged to play a role in His.
  • Living life to make "my" mark is too small a thing for us to give our whole life to
Rob Bell
  • Faith and doubt dance together
  • Less is more; inverse fidelity
  • The 10 Commandments: First 9 are externally measurable/observable; obeying the 10th is a "reward" for obeying the first 9. When you obey the first 9, you won't want what somebody else has
Matt Chandler
  • EVERYTHING God creates rolls up into worship
  • What God has said He was going to do is HAPPENING NOW. We're caught up in something bigger than we can even imagine
  • Let confession and repentance be a continuing ethic for us
Frances Chan
  • WE WERE DEAD. But Jesus saved us. Ephesians 2. When was the last time you thought "I should be in hell right now?"
  • We are arrogant to think that we alone can change the world. Only God can do that.
  • Who cares if people won't restore you? The God of all grace will.
Chuck Swindoll
  • Brokenness and failure are necessary
  • We must be willing to leave the familiar methods without disturbing the biblical message
  • Drip with gratitude and grace
Louie Giglio
  • As my life becomes about Jesus, it becomes all that life is meant to be about
  • The time is NOW for us to process, to live out, to move out, to do something, to take action
  • "Your life is shaped by the end you live for. You are made in the image of what you desire." - Thomas Merton
